  • This version of macOS 10.12 cannot be installed on this computer.

    What does that mean? I try to download on the App store and I get a popup saying "this 10.12 macOS version can not be installed on this computer."  I click on "Learn more" and nothing happens.  I've recently upgraded to El Capitan without problem.  I am running a mid 2007 24 "iMac that works as good as the day I bought it! Help!

    The message is correct. See below.

    • MacBook (late 2009 or newer)
    • MacBook Pro (mid-2010 or more recent)
    • MacBook Air (late 2010 or newer)
    • Mac mini (mid-2010 or more recent)
    • iMac (late 2009 or newer)
    • Mac Pro (mid-2010 or more recent)

  • MacBook Pro crashed trying to load Mac OS Sierra. Can't back up.

    Try to upgrade to Mac OS Sierra.  Have a MacBook Pro (2011).  Latest operating system running.  Make the backup.  Downloaded Mac OS Sierra.  Settle.  Installation failed.  Retried, installation failed again.  I now trying to recover from a backup, but can not get the system to start.  I have only a screen with several languages, I chose English, but he was just sitting there with several languages scrolling on the screen.

    Hey Rocket281,

    If I understand correctly, you tried to install macOS a few times and it failed. Now you're stuck on language selection screen and it will not progress. I recommend you read this article, it explains how to start on the recovery screen and install a new version of Mac OS or disk utility to repair any problems, it can be seen.

    To boot from recovery macOS, hold down the command (⌘) r immediately after start-up or that you restart your Mac. Release when you see the Apple logo.

    • Backup restore Time Machine: Restore your Mac from an external hard drive or a Time Capsule that contains a Time Machine backup of your Mac.
    • Reinstall macOS*: download and reinstall macOS on your startup disk. macOS (command-R) recovery installs the latest macOS version installed on your Mac. macOS Internet recovery (Command-Option-R) installs the version originally supplied with your Mac.
    • Get help online*: use Safari to surf the web and find help for your Mac. Links to the Apple support Web site are included. Browser plug-ins and extensions are disabled.
    • Disk utility: Use disk utility to repair or Erase your startup disk or another hard drive.

    On macOS recovery - Apple Support
